Cayenne peppers have a very earthy flavor that has become the signature taste of southwest US cooking. It’s a very versatile pepper that generally doesn’t pack a whole lot of heat, so everyone can enjoy dishes made with it. This hot sauce is on the upper end of mild, but maintains the true taste of cayenne. You’ll find it makes a great addition to your own salsa and even as an addition to mole sauces.
